I sorta feel stupid for asking this, but what would be the difference then between a malthiest and an athiest?

Maltheists believe that God exists, and think that God is evil. Atheists do not believe in God, so any supposition about him being Good and evil is superfluous, at best.

I find the idea of maltheism to be quite interesting, because it demonstrates how a person can read the same source of knowledge (the Bible) and come up with vastly different conclusions as to the nature of God.
